#CBF986 Color
#CBF986 is rgb(203, 249, 134) in RGB, hsl(84, 91%, 75%) in HSL, and about cmyk(18%, 0%, 46%, 2%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Mindaro (#E3F988),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.34.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CBF986 Channel Values
How #CBF986 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 203 · G 249 · B 134 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 84° · S 91% · L 75%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 84° · S 46% · V 98%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 18% · M 0% · Y 46% · K 2%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.2:1 vs white · 17.43: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#CBF986 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CBF986?
#CBF986 is a light green — rgb(203, 249, 134) in RGB and hsl(84, 91%, 75%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Mindaro (#E3F988),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.34.
What is the RGB value of #CBF986?
#CBF986 is rgb(203, 249, 134) — red 203, green 249, and blue 134 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CBF986?
#CBF986 converts to approximately cmyk(18%, 0%, 46%, 2%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CBF986 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CBF986 scores 1.2:1 against white and 17.43: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CBF986 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CBF986 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is palegreen (#98FB98) at a CIE76 distance of 20.11, which is visibly different.
